The concept of this blog is to muscle through and discuss the 123* films on the AFI's "100 Years...100 Movies" list. We say 123 films because the original list came out in 1997 and was updated for their 10th anniversary. Some films were added to the list and some were removed. We wanted to have a comprehensive list of all the films they have ranked. We will judge from there how well they chose the greatest films of American cinema.

If we were really crazy, we would watch all the hundreds of nominated films and then create our own top 100. However, we want to have some kind of a life outside this list, so we chose to critique the 123 films that actually made the cut.
